I have seen a lot of workarounds for traffic lights but cannot find the option as shown in the picture below where the icon appears. I grabbed this from POWER BI file but I cannot figure out how it was created. Where is this option such that this traffic light icon appears next to the field name?

Hi @Maureen ,
This symbol indicates a KPI which is a calculated measures you could create in Power Pivot or SQL Server Analysis Service. When you import the data to the Power BI Desktop, it may look like a Traffic Signal indicator.
